Paraguay
Established 2000
Sites: 7—Children Served: 316

A tall man, Victor Verruck squats down on the packed dirt of the open air classroom amid a swarm of smiling brown faces.  His genuine patience and love are evident in his manner as he shares the story of a loving Savior with the Guarani Indian children of impoverished rural Paraguay. As with each child, Victor helped each one write their name while emphasizing the theme God Knows Your Name. 

Children’s Christian Concern Society is blessed to partner with directors such as Victor to bring the Good News of Jesus to children through education. Through this partnership, CCCS supports the CPTLN Little Bible School projects at nine sites by providing teaching materials. While volunteers in the local Lutheran churches hold weekly Bible schools, Victor makes monthly hikes to these remote locations and inner- city cites and oversees the programs. 

On a recent trip to Paraguay, Dr. Edith Jorns, CCCS Projects Director, commented on Victor’s leadership. “He’s just so passionate about everything he does. The challenge is letting people know what dedicated and passionate people there are in the International Lutheran Hour Ministries’ programs.  When he went into those preschools, the kids just ran to put their arms around him. The parents greeted him warmly, too. When we visited the Ascuncion Little Bible School in the garbage district, we were told the taxi drivers wouldn’t  go into these neighborhoods. Yet Victor was well known and well loved by all.”

 In Latin America, Lutheran Hour Ministries is known as CPTLN, Cristo para Todos Las Naciones or, in English, Christ for All the Nations.

I’m sending  you this letter to thank you for helping me to continue studying in this school. My father just died of leukemia, and I want to continue my studies. Especially in a school that teaches people to learn about Jesus. Without this help, it would be impossible for me to go to school. I have a mother and 4 brothers and one is sick and needs an operation. Everything bothers me because I don’t want to have to leave school. I promise you I will be a good student, study hard and not defraud you.
This school is one I really like, especially because of the religious teaching. It is very important that I have your support to continue studying.

Kevin Douglas Teloken
Santa Cruz school
Hohenau, Itapua, Paraguay
